摘要
The enhancement of surface enhanced Raman scattering (SERS) with nanogap-rich silver nanoislands surrounding glass nanopillars at wafer level is reported. High-density hot spots are generated by increasing the number of nanogap-rich nanoislands within a detection volume. The SERS substrate shows a high enhancement factor of over 10 7 with excellent signal uniformity (7.8%) and it enables the label-free detection of aqueous DNA base molecules at nanomolar level.
